Quarterly Planning Note — Retirement of the Corvid Series

The board is asked to note the staged retirement of the Corvid instrument line. Support obligations run through next fiscal year; inventory will be drawn down without fire-sale discounting. Customer migration paths to the Pelline platform are documented. Projected one-time costs remain within the approved envelope. The underlying plan appears below.

management briefing: The southern region missed its Norius quota by 65.3 percent last quarter. Gilaxek Systems plans to lower the Tamvan list price by 21.5 percent in May. The finance team signed off on a budget of $36.1 million for Project Casix. The renewal with Tamvanox Freight closes at $23.3 million a year, 25.9 percent below the last contract.

# Circuit breaker settings for the upstream Parcelwind routing API.
# The breaker trips after five consecutive failures and stays open for
# sixty seconds before allowing a probe request. These thresholds were
# tuned during the Marlot incident review; do not lower them without
# checking with the platform team first. Half-open state allows one
# request at a time. The breaker also requires an auth token to call
# the Parcelwind health endpoint. That token is set on the next line.

sealed setting: LEDGER_TOKEN13=b4a1a6f880cb4

Subject: Haulpoint assignment heuristic — candidate build ready

Team, the revised driver-assignment heuristic is ready for review. Changes: idle-time weighting now decays over 15 minutes, and the proximity score ignores drivers mid-handoff, which removes the ping-pong reassignment we saw in the Lornbay trial. Unit coverage is at 94% on the scoring module. Please review the scoring refactor specifically. The build under review is identified by the token below.

trace token, kahop-kawig: htk31_e2fe3bacfec87140102308db6544991

## Deployment

FareForge, our shipping-fee rules engine, deploys from the main branch via the Lanternworks pipeline. Each merge builds an image, runs the tariff regression suite, and promotes to staging automatically; production promotion needs one approval. Rules are hot-reloaded, so most changes don't require a restart. The service boots with the following configuration values.

settings of fafog-haduf:
ZORIX_PIN=4648
ZORIX_METRICS_HOST=metrics.zorix.paliqsys.corp
ZORIX_LOG_LEVEL=info
ZORIX_TENANT=druix